Oracle Truss提升数据库运行效率(oracle truss)
Oracle Truss提升数据库运行效率
随着企业规模的不断扩大和业务的日益复杂,数据库运行效率变得尤为重要。为了确保数据库的高效运行,Oracle数据库引入了Truss工具,可以帮助管理员快速定位并解决数据库的性能瓶颈问题。
Truss在Oracle中的作用
Truss是Oracle提供的一个调试工具,可以帮助管理员识别在数据库中执行的进程和系统调用,以排查性能问题。Truss可用于跟踪系统调用、信号和进程相关的情况,包括文件读取、内存分配、网络通信等。当数据库性能问题出现时,Truss可以帮助管理员快速发现问题所在,并提供相应的解决方案,从而提升数据库的运行效率。
如何使用Truss
使用Truss进行调试的步骤分为以下几个步骤:
1. 执行单个命令
要使用Truss追踪单个命令的输出,可以使用以下命令:
truss -p PID
其中PID是要追踪的进程ID。
2. 在已经运行的进程中添加Truss
如果要在已经运行的进程中添加Truss,可以使用以下命令:
truss -p PID -t all -o outputfile
其中PID是要追踪的进程ID, -t all表示追踪所有的调用,-o outputfile表示将输出保存到指定的文件中。
3. 使用Truss指定执行的命令
要追踪在执行命令时发生的系统调用,可以使用以下命令:
truss -o outputfile command
其中command是要执行的命令,-o outputfile表示将输出保存到指定的文件中。
4. Truss常用选项
Truss提供了一系列选项来满足不同的调试需求,以下是一些常用选项:
-a :将输出显示在标准错误输出中;
-d :指定文件描述符,用于捕获系统调用;
-e :指定要追踪的系统调用;
-f :追踪所有的系统调用;
-m :指定进程的内存分配;
-P :指定进程的策略;
-r :输出每个系统调用的返回值。
结论
Truss是Oracle数据库的一个强大的调试工具。使用Truss,管理员可以轻松追踪系统调用、信号和进程相关的情况,以发现任何性能瓶颈问题。对于需要提高Oracle数据库性能的管理员来说,Truss是一种不可或缺的工具,是实现高效数据管理的必备应用程序之一。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 Oracle Truss提升数据库运行效率(oracle truss)
相关文章
- Oracle提取字符串前几位的技巧(oracle截取字符串前几位)
- Oracle数据库自动备份设置操作指南(oracle自动备份设置)
- 文件恢复Oracle误删DBF文件的方法(oracle误删dbf)
- Linux下连接Oracle数据库的步骤指南(linux连接oracle数据库)
- 掌握Oracle数据库表的创建技巧(创建oracle数据库表)
- Oracle数据库中的触发器类型简介(oracle触发器类型)
- 研究Oracle数据库中的触发器类型(oracle触发器类型)
- 探索Oracle数据库中触发器的类型(oracle触发器类型)
- 数据库设计探索沈阳:从Oracle数据库设计开始(沈阳oracle)
- Oracle数据库步骤详解:实现简单的配置(oracle配置教程)
- Oracle数据库中如何创建数据表(oracle 创建数据表)
- 了解Oracle的在IT行业的重要性(itl oracle)
- 使用Oracle批量写入多条数据(oracle写入多条数据)
- 使用Oracle共享锁提高数据库性能(oracle共享锁语句)
- Oracle防火墙入站规则完善保护网络(oracle 入站规则)
- OEM实现Oracle数据库管理简易化(oem管理oracle)
- Oracle数据库中实现去重的技术(oracle中的去重)
- 死Oracle实例互相紧急卡死了(oracle两个实例卡)
- 永恒的Oracle无需担心过期问题(oracle 不过期时间)
- Oracle无法正确识别小数点(oracle不能识别圆点)
- Oracle中不使用事务的数据更新(oracle不用事务更新)
- Oracle无法实现兼容性(oracle不兼容)
- 善用Oracle Out应用,有效提升业务效率(oracle out应用)
- Oracle MV技术数据库领域的利器(oracle mv技术)
- Oracle 25228新一代数据库技术革新(oracle 25228)
- Oracle 11把优秀变得更出色(oracle 11体系)
- Oracle 11g推荐 优质的数据库解决方案(oracle11g推荐)